SmoothSale welcomes you to this extended and beautifully maintained four-bedroom detached house, located in the highly regarded Ensbury Park area and falling within the sought-after Hill View School catchment.
Generously arranged over three floors, this property offers versatile and spacious living ideal for families or those needing space to work from home.
On the ground floor, the accommodation flows from a welcoming entrance hall into a generous dual-aspect lounge/diner, a second reception room, and a bright conservatory that seamlessly opens to the garden—ideal for year-round enjoyment. The kitchen/breakfast room offers ample storage and space for appliances, making it a practical and social hub of the home. A convenient downstairs WC completes the ground floor.
Upstairs, there are four well-proportioned bedrooms, two bathrooms (a main family bathroom and a separate shower room), and access to a versatile loft room on the second floor—perfect for a study, playroom, or hobby area.
Externally, the well-maintained rear garden features both patio and decking areas, ideal for entertaining or relaxing outdoors. To the front, the home offers off-street parking and a garage, with gated side access to the rear.
The location is perfect for families, with a selection of schools for all age groups nearby. Local amenities and bus routes are available along Winton High Street, while Castlepoint Shopping Centre is just a short drive away for convenient one-stop shopping.

You can secure this property with an optional reservation deposit of £2,500. This forms part of the property's total purchase price and is not an additional fee. The deposit draws up a legally binding exclusivity agreement which gives exclusive rights to purchase the property within an agreed timeframe.
The reservation deposit guarantees that the seller will remove their property from the market as soon as the offer is accepted and the deposit is paid. This means that the property is reserved for you, giving you time to complete the sale without the risk of being gazumped.
The fixed exclusivity period (typically 8-10 weeks) allows you to prepare financing, surveys and property searches with the confidence that you aren't wasting money on a sale that may fall through.
